#include "controller/python/ChipDeviceController-StorageDelegate.h"
#include <cstring>
#include <map>
#include <string>
#include <core/CHIPPersistentStorageDelegate.h>
#include <support/logging/CHIPLogging.h>
namespace chip {
namespace Controller {
void PythonPersistentStorageDelegate::SetStorageDelegate(PersistentStorageResultDelegate * delegate)
{
mDelegate = delegate;
}
CHIP_ERROR PythonPersistentStorageDelegate::SyncGetKeyValue(const char * key, char * value, uint16_t & size)
{
auto val = mStorage.find(key);
if (val == mStorage.end())
{
return CHIP_ERROR_KEY_NOT_FOUND;
}
if (value == nullptr)
{
size = 0;
}
uint16_t neededSize = val->second.size() + 1;
if (size == 0)
{
size = neededSize;
return CHIP_ERROR_NO_MEMORY;
}
if (size < neededSize)
{
memcpy(value, val->second.c_str(), size - 1);
value[size - 1] = '\0';
size = neededSize;
return CHIP_ERROR_NO_MEMORY;
}
memcpy(value, val->second.c_str(), neededSize);
size = neededSize;
return CHIP_NO_ERROR;
}
void PythonPersistentStorageDelegate::AsyncSetKeyValue(const char * key, const char * value)
{
mStorage[key] = value;
ChipLogDetail(Controller, "AsyncSetKeyValue: %s=%s", key, value);
mDelegate->OnPersistentStorageStatus(key, PersistentStorageResultDelegate::Operation::kSET, CHIP_NO_ERROR);
}
void PythonPersistentStorageDelegate::AsyncDeleteKeyValue(const char * key)
{
mStorage.erase(key);
mDelegate->OnPersistentStorageStatus(key, PersistentStorageResultDelegate::Operation::kDELETE, CHIP_NO_ERROR);
}
} // namespace Controller
} // namespace chip
